The BJC RN Career Ladder differentiates BJC as the place for nurses to work in the greater St. Louis area. 

This is a tool to empower nurses to work at the top of their license and own their career progression.

The BJC RN Career Ladder promotes professional development, leadership, collaboration, education and service excellence and gives staff the opportunity to continue doing what they do best - caring for patients - while having the opportunity to advance to the next step in their career. 

Moves to higher ladder levels will result in a percentage increase of current pay that aligns with the new job description.


Overview

The Alvin J. Siteman Cancer Center at Barnes-Jewish Hospital and Washington University School of Medicine is an international leader in cancer treatment, research, prevention, education and community outreach. It is the only cancer center in Missouri and within a 240-mile radius of St. Louis to hold the prestigious Comprehensive Cancer Center designation from the National Cancer Institute and membership in the National Comprehensive Cancer Network. Parent institutions Barnes-Jewish Hospital and Washington University School of Medicine also are nationally recognized, with U.S. News & World Report consistently ranking the hospital and medical school among the nation's elite.

 

Division 11800 is a 32-bed single occupancy unit that provides care to oncology patients who are hospitalized for cancer treatment and symptom management, including support for immunosuppression and/or neutropenia. The care is moderate to high acuity. Care includes high complexity interventions serving patients on both the Bone Marrow Transplant (BMT) and Oncology services. The presence of two services provides broad oncology experiences for the nurse. Care is coordinated by a multidisciplinary team including oncology nurses, advanced practice nurses, case managers, coordinators, social workers, spiritual care, pharmacy and psycho-social support. Professional nursing growth and development are expected, encouraged and supported by the Oncology Nursing Fellowship Program for new graduate nurses, the Career Ladder Program, the Oncology Nursing Society's (ONS) Chemotherapy and Biotherapy Course, and educational preparation for the Oncology Certified Nurse (OCN) program.
